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Haltom City Apartments

What is the Cheapest Studio apartment in Haltom City?

Currently the most affordable Cheap Studio Apartment in Haltom City is at Fusion Fort Worth listed at $829.

How much is rent for a Cheap One Bedroom Haltom City Apartment?

The lowest price for a Cheap One Bedroom Haltom City Apartment is $675 at Chapman.

What is the lowest price for a Cheap Two Bedroom Haltom City Apartment for rent?

Today's best deal for a Cheap Two Bedroom Apartment in Haltom City is starting from $900 at Chapman.

What is the most affordable Haltom City Three Bedroom Apartment?

The best deal on a cheap Haltom City Three Bedroom Apartment rental is at Chapman and starts from $1,055.
